Upon arriving at the dining hall, Liu Shunyi discovered a disheartening fact.

That damn Shen Kaiyang had swiped all his Spirit Stones and even siphoned away the merit points he earned from his labor as a servant disciple.

Now, Liu Shunyi was left utterly destitute.

Feeling deeply aggrieved, he mentally cursed Shen Kaiyang to death.

But the immediate problem remained – what should he do now? He couldn’t simply starve to death.

Liu Shunyi paced back and forth outside the dining hall, eventually letting out a resigned sigh.

In the cultivation world, borrowing money was practically impossible. Encountering genuinely kind people was also exceedingly rare.

As for eating…

Liu Shunyi could only gaze at the wild vegetables growing by the roadside. With no other choice, he started gathering them.

‘Fucking hell, I might just be the most unfortunate transmigrator in history!’ Liu Shunyi lamented inwardly, close to tears.

However, compared to earlier, his mood had somewhat improved.

At least, he still possessed his unique ability.

After all, as long as his enemy persisted, there would be a chance for him to rise above.

He remained hopeful for his eventual rise.

Once he had gathered enough wild greens, Liu Shunyi promptly left the area.

There was no choice.

As a cultivator, digging for roadside vegetables with curious stares from others felt quite embarrassing.

Nevertheless, it wasn’t enough to sustain him.

Liu Shunyi ventured to the mountains behind the sect, specifically hunting for some game.

After satisfying his hunger and thirst,

with nothing else pressing to do,

Liu Shunyi returned directly to the servant disciples’ courtyard.

His first priority was to earn merit points.

“Brother, let me help you with your tasks, and I’ll take just three merit points as my share!” Liu Shunyi approached several servant disciples, making his proposition.

The servant disciples found the offer appealing.

Soon after, Liu Shunyi embarked on a frenzy of work mode, showing no signs of laziness and achieving remarkably high efficiency.

This astonished the other servants, leaving them dumbfounded.

Continuing his spree, Liu Shunyi took on more tasks from various servants.

Upon completing them,

he decided not to accept any further assignments.

One reason being Cui Hao’s exhaustion,

and another being that relentless overworking without rest would raise suspicions.

Working tirelessly at such a frenzied pace inevitably drew attention, making others feel it was quite peculiar.

Liu Shunyi’s face flushed red from exhaustion, his neck veins bulging, and sweat drenched his body completely.

Of course, this was all an act.

However, the effect was remarkably convincing.

By the end of the day, he earned thirty merit points.

Considering Green Lotus Sect’s exchange rates, that equaled thirty yuan!

Liu Shunyi exclaimed internally:

“Damn!”

Frustrated, he slammed his hand on the table.

This place truly seemed unbearable for humans.

Fortunately,

tomorrow he could finally dine at the cafeteria again.

With those thirty merit points, he’d afford one meal.

Just thinking about it made Liu Shunyi’s stomach grumble anew.

Over these past few days, by transferring negative states and absorbing light from Shen Kaiyang’s name, Liu Shunyi had also strengthened his own body significantly.

It wasn’t an exaggeration to say that now, Liu Shunyi was effectively a Cultivator at Body Refinement Third Layer.

He could effortlessly punch through a bull with a single blow.

However, as expected, his appetite had become voracious.

“This can’t go on!”

Having acquired an external advantage, Liu Shunyi began contemplating his future plans.

Firstly, he needed to enhance his cultivation base.

Hmm.

Although Shen Kaiyang’s name hadn’t regained its glow yet, the shared effects of the low-grade Spirit Root remained intact.

Liu Shunyi took a deep gulp of water and started cultivating fervently.

Perhaps due to his enhanced physique, this time, while absorbing heaven and earth spiritual energy, his meridians did not tear.

“Hmph, seems like Cui Hao got off easy!” Liu Shunyi sneered, dismissing further thoughts and continued his cultivation.

***

In no time, it was the next day.

Liu Shunyi woke up early, gazing at Cui Hao’s name, now dimmed without its previous glow.

Feeling somewhat melancholic, he muttered, “This year’s rivals are the weakest I’ve ever seen!”

Fortunately for Liu Shunyi, his relentless work over these two days had left the servant disciples’ courtyard unusually quiet. A few of them gathered to chat idly.

Seeing as Liu Shunyi also had some free time, he grabbed a handful of sunflower seeds and joined the conversation.

“Hey, have you heard? That Senior Brother Shen, who always exploited us, has been crippled!” someone exclaimed.

Upon hearing this, everyone froze momentarily before bursting with relief.

Some even expressed their intention to descend the mountain immediately to offer thanks.

One disciple, particularly elated, said, “Wonderful! I don’t know which immortal did us this favor, but if I meet him, I’d gladly bow down in gratitude!”

Liu Shunyi listened silently from the side but couldn’t resist asking, “How was he crippled? Any details? Is there any chance of recovery?”

A fellow servant disciple shook his head.

“I heard his meridians were completely severed; he’ll never be able to cultivate again. As for recovery, it’s not entirely impossible with top-tier Healing Pills.”

“Considering Shen Kaiyang only had low-grade Spirit Roots as an Outer Sect disciple, who would waste such high-quality Medicine Pills on him!”

Liu Shunyi nodded, his face reflecting genuine satisfaction and relief – this was no act.

However, now Liu Shunyi needed to find a more formidable enemy, but not too powerful either.

Currently, he was still weak. If he angered someone truly strong, they could easily crush him with a single blow. Moreover, there was no guarantee that his designated enemy would always take the fall for him.

On this matter, Liu Shunyi couldn’t afford any risks. It seemed prudent to carefully plan his next move.

For now, his immediate priority was to earn money.

But with no available work for servant disciples here, he needed to find a more lucrative opportunity.

His only option appeared to be taking miscellaneous tasks within the Outer Sect.

Yet, Liu Shunyi hesitated to venture there at present.

One misstep, and he risked getting injured amidst the Outer Sect’s constant duels.

‘Damn it, all because my strength is still too low!’

Taking advantage of having these servants around, Liu Shunyi decided to ask them directly.

“Senior Brothers, Shen Kaiyang stripped me of this month’s stipend, leaving me penniless. Could you please guide me towards a more lucrative opportunity!”

The other servants looked at Liu Shunyi with sympathy.

However, one of them genuinely offered a suggestion.
“Brother, you seem quite strong. How about I introduce you to a job?

“But remember, we split the Spirit Stones fifty-fifty, and it’s a significant gig!”

Liu Shunyi was taken aback.
“Senior Brother, is this job…legitimate?”

The servant disciple chuckled slyly.
“Aren’t you eager to make money? This job pays handsomely!”

Liu Shunyi eyed the disciple suspiciously.
“Could you give me some details first?”

The servant disciple gestured discreetly, signaling Liu Shunyi to come closer.

Liu Shunyi promptly moved nearer.

In a hushed tone, the servant disciple whispered something.

Instantly, Liu Shunyi shook his head vigorously.
“No way, no way. I can’t do that.”

Internally, he was speechless.
*This jerk, trying to set me up.*

*Damn, even listed on the Grand Dao Golden Book now.*

To Liu Shunyi’s shock, both Cui Hao and Shen Kaiyang had their names glowing faintly white.

Impressive!

Yet, what truly stunned him was Zhang Erhu’s name – it glowed green.

Wow, Zhang Erhu, hiding deep indeed.

Naturally, Liu Shunyi became increasingly cautious.

He wasn’t sure what the green glow signified, but he knew for certain that it couldn’t be associated with a mere servant disciple.

Even Shen Kaiyang, being a waste, had reached the Outer Sect, so there was no way Zhang Erhu could just be a servant.

Could he possibly be a spy from another sect?
